Roy Drusky

If The Whole World Stopped Lovin'

(# 17 top country album)

Mercury SR-61097
Nov / 1966

Produced by Jerry Kennedy

Cover image of If The Whole World Stopped Lovin'

Jerry Kennedy - guitar/dobro/sitar
Harold Bradley, Ray Edenton - guitar
Pete Drake - steel
Bob Moore - bass
Buddy Harman - drums
Hargus Pig Robbins - piano
Recorded:
Aug/1966, Columbia Studio, Nashville
